1. Teaching Methodology

Traditional vs. Modern Approaches

English training classes employ various teaching methodologies, ranging from traditional methods to more modern approaches. Traditional methods often focus on grammar drills and vocabulary memorization, while modern approaches emphasize communicative skills and real-life language usage. According to Zhihu contributors, the effectiveness of English training classes largely depends on the teaching methodology employed. Modern approaches that prioritize practical language skills tend to yield better results.

Interactive Learning

Another crucial aspect of English training classes is interactive learning. Zhihu contributors emphasize the importance of active participation and engagement in the learning process. Classes that encourage students to speak, practice, and interact with both the teacher and fellow classmates are generally considered more effective. Such interactive learning environments provide ample opportunities for students to apply their knowledge and improve their English proficiency.

2. Qualified Instructors

Native vs. Non-Native Teachers

The qualifications of English instructors play a significant role in the effectiveness of training classes. Zhihu contributors highlight the advantages of having native English speakers as teachers. Native speakers can provide authentic language input, help students develop proper pronunciation and intonation, and offer insights into cultural nuances. However, it is worth noting that non-native teachers who possess excellent language skills and teaching expertise can also deliver effective English training.

Teaching Experience and Expertise

In addition to language proficiency, teaching experience and expertise are crucial factors in determining the effectiveness of English training classes. Experienced teachers are more adept at identifying students' weaknesses and tailoring their teaching methods accordingly. Moreover, teachers with subject-specific expertise can provide in-depth knowledge and guidance, enhancing the overall learning experience.

3. Curriculum and Materials

Relevance and Authenticity

The curriculum and materials utilized in English training classes greatly influence their effectiveness. Zhihu contributors emphasize the importance of using relevant and authentic materials that reflect real-life language usage. Textbooks, articles, videos, and other resources should be up-to-date and engaging, enabling students to develop practical language skills and cultural understanding.

Customization and Flexibility

English training classes that offer customized curricula and flexible learning options are often more effective. Zhihu contributors suggest that tailoring the curriculum to meet individual students' needs and goals can significantly enhance their learning experience. Additionally, classes that provide flexible scheduling and learning formats, such as online courses or blended learning, can accommodate students' diverse lifestyles and preferences.

4. Learning Environment

Class Size

The learning environment, particularly class size, is an essential factor in the effectiveness of English training classes. According to Zhihu contributors, smaller class sizes tend to be more conducive to interactive learning and individualized attention. With fewer students, teachers can provide personalized feedback and address each student's specific needs, resulting in better learning outcomes.

Supportive Atmosphere

A supportive and encouraging learning atmosphere is crucial for effective English training. Zhihu contributors emphasize the importance of creating a safe space where students feel comfortable making mistakes and practicing their English skills. Positive reinforcement and constructive feedback from both teachers and classmates can boost students' confidence and motivation, ultimately leading to better results.
